Census Bureau: More women than men in Drexel in 2020

Of the 885 people living in Drexel in 2020, 50.1 percent (443) were women and 49.9 percent (442) were men, according to U.S. Census Bureau data obtained by the South KC News.

Males 18 and over outnumbered females in the same age group by 18. In the 65 and over age range, there were 112 females and 96 males.

An agency of the U.S. Federal Statistical System, the Census Bureau is responsible for compiling statistical facts about the American people, places and economy. Data for this story was compiled from the bureau’s American Community Survey. Information from the survey helps to determine how federal and state funds are distributed.

Drexel’s population by sex
Sex and age range Estimated number Percent of total
Males 18 and over 245 27.7
Females 18 and over 227 25.6
Males 65 and over 96 10.8
Females 65 and over 112 12.7

Source: US Census Bureau
